The applicant shall make its fair share contribution to mitigate the potential <br /> regional impacts of the project with respect to roads, park, fire, police and solid <br /> waste disposal facilities. The fair share contribution shall be initially based on <br /> the representations contained within the change of zone application and may be <br /> increased or reduced proportionally if the lot counts are adjusted. The fair <br /> share contribution shall become due and payable prior to final subdivision <br /> approval of any portion of the subject property or its increments. The fair share <br /> contribution for each lot shall be based on a maximum density for each lot as <br /> determined by the zoning resulting from this change of zone. The fair share <br /> contribution in a form of cash, land, facilities or any combination thereof shall <br /> be determined by the County Council. The fair share contribution may be <br /> adjusted annually beginning three years after the effective date of this <br /> ordinance, based on the percentage change in the Honolulu Consumer Price <br /> Index (HCPI). In lieu of paying the fair share contribution, the applicant may <br /> construct and contribute improvements /facilities related to roads, park, fire, <br /> police and solid waste disposal facilities within the region impacted by the <br /> proposed development with the approval of the appropriate agency(ies). The <br /> cost of constructing the improvements required in Conditions F and G, the fair <br /> market value of land contributed pursuant to Condition G, and prior cash <br /> contributions toward the planning of the Alii Highway project, shall be credited <br /> against the road and traffic improvements. Any contributions required by this <br /> ordinance that exceed the fair share requirement of this proposed development <br /> shall, at the applicant's request be credited towards any of the applicant's future <br /> developments that require infrastructural impact contributions. <br /> P.
